What is recorded here

A possible promontory fort consisting of a narrow west-facing headland cut off from the mainland by a substantial earthen bank was seen from the air on the coastline between Cliffony and Grange villages (Casey 1999, 198). Its exact location could not be identified on OS maps or on the ground. Compiled by: Jane O’Shaughnessy Date of upload: 4 December 2018
